Mobile’s humid subtropical climate and coastal storms make storage planning crucial for protecting your belongings. With average humidity levels above 70% and frequent thunderstorms, you’ll want to prioritize moisture protection and secure access when choosing a storage unit.
Average Storage Unit Prices in Mobile, AL
Here’s what you can expect to pay for Mobile storage units:
5’x5′ | $42 |
10’x10′ | $82 |
10’x15′ | $122 |
10’x20′ | $138 |
What to Look for in a Mobile Storage Unit
- Humidity Defense: With year-round humidity exceeding 70%, climate-controlled units are essential for protecting electronics, furniture, and documents from moisture damage and mold growth.
- Storm Protection: Mobile receives over 65 inches of rain annually. Look for facilities with covered loading areas and sealed indoor units to keep belongings dry during frequent thunderstorms.
- Security Priorities: Mobile’s property crime rate of 42 per 1,000 residents calls for facilities with gated access, surveillance cameras, and individual unit alarms for peace of mind.
- Port and Highway Access: Choose storage near I-65 or I-10 for convenient access, especially if you’re storing business inventory or need frequent visits during peak traffic hours.

Do Mobile storage units protect against hurricane damage?
Many facilities offer reinforced construction and elevated units. Ask about storm protocols and whether the facility has backup power during hurricane season.
Can I store a boat or RV in Mobile?
Yes. Many facilities offer oversized outdoor parking spaces for boats, RVs, and trailers, especially useful given Mobile’s proximity to Mobile Bay and the Gulf Coast.
Is it safe to access storage units at night near the port?
Choose facilities with 24/7 lighting, surveillance systems, and secure entry codes if you need after-hours access in industrial or port areas.
Do I need special protection for storing fishing gear?
Yes. Clean and dry all equipment before storage, and consider climate-controlled units to prevent rust and mildew on rods, reels, and tackle boxes.
